The Impact of Legumes vs Corn-soy Flour on Environmental Enteric Dysfunction in Rural Malawian Children 6-11 Months

To determine if 6 months of legume-based complementary foods is effective in reducing or reversing EED and linear growth faltering in a cohort of Malawian children, aged 6-11 months to see if these improvements are correlated with specific changes in the enteric microbiome.

Inclusion criteria

children residing in catchment area of Limela, Machinga District and Ntenda (Chikwawa District), Malawi aged 6-11 months youngest eligible child in each household

Exclusion criteria

Unable to drink 20 mL of sugar water Demonstrating evidence of severe acute malnutrition Apparent need for acute medical treatment for an illness or injury Caregiver refusal to participate and return for 3 and 6 month follow-ups -

Treatment and study plan

Cow pea complementary food

Dietary Supplement

A legume-based complementary food made from cowpeas will be given for 6 months, 200 kcal/day for children 6-9 months old and 300 kcal/day for children 9-11 months old.

Corn soy flour

Dietary Supplement

Corn flour with 10% soy will be given for 6 months, 200 kcal/day for children 6-9 months old and 300 kcal/day for children 9-11 months old.

Common bean

Dietary Supplement

A legume-based complementary food made from common beans will be given for 6 months,200 kcal/day for children 6-9 months old and 300 kcal/day for children 9-11 months old.

Primary outcomes

  1. Change in Length-for-age z Score Over 6 Months From Enrollment to End of Study.

    Time frame: 6 months

    Change in length-for-age z score from enrollment to end of study 6 months

  2. % Lactulose From Dual Sugar Absorption Test at 9 and 12 Months of Age

    Time frame: 6 month

    percent of lactulose found in urine during the dual sugar absorption test

Secondary outcomes

  1. 16S Configuration of Fecal Microbiota at 6.5, 7.5, 9, 10.5 and 12 Months of Age Comparing Supplementary Food Groups

    Time frame: 6 months

  2. Mid-upper Arm Circumference at 9 and 12 Months of Age

    Time frame: 6 months

    Mid-upper arm circumference in cm

  3. Weight-for-height z Score at 9 and 12 Months of Age

    Time frame: 6 months

    weight for height z-score at 9 and 12 months of age

  4. Association of 16S Configuration of Fecal Microbiome With Demographic, Anthropometric, Intestinal Permeability, Sanitation and Antibiotic Exposure Characteristics of the Study Population

    Time frame: 6 months
